Europe’s wildfires are getting worse. This year is on pace to break last year’s record—the most destructive fire season on the continent ever recorded. The main culprit? A combination of extreme heat, prolonged drought, and strong winds. These conditions, scientists say, are being amplified by climate change, turning normal summer fires into megafires that are harder to contain and faster to spread. In Spain and France, the blazes have already forced mass evacuations and destroyed thousands of hectares of land. The message from experts is clear: what once was a seasonal threat is now a year-round danger.
